KABUL - US top envoy on Afghanistan Zalmay Khalilzad hints at conditional withdrawal of US troops from Afghanistan.

The U.S. envoy for Afghan peace Ambassador Zalmay Khalilzad has said withdrawal from Afghanistan will be condition-based.

Ambassador Khalilzad said in a Twitter post that the presence of the United States in Afghanistan is condition-based.

Furthermore, Ambassador Khalilzad said the United States is pursuing a peace agreement not a withdrawal agreement.

He also added that he has arrived in Doha and that U.S. is ready for a good agreement with Taliban.

According to Khalilzad, the Taliban are signaling they would like to conclude an agreement.

This comes as certain American media outlets had earlier reported that the United States is prepared to withdraw thousands of U.S. forces from Afghanistan if a peace deal is concluded with Taliban.
